After a successful 2024 festival, comprising over 130 events and reaching total audience numbers of over 110,000, the third annual WestFest will take place this year from 1st to 29th June.
WestFest 2025 will feature the usual mix of street festivals, concerts, community events, recitals, and exhibitions. Attendees can also look forward to the return of some festival favourites such as Big Sunday @ Kelvingrove Bandstand, Bard in the Botanics, the Glasgow Vintage Bus Tour and the ever popular Kelvingrove Outdoor Ceilidh.
The highlight for many will be the colourful, free programme of outdoor events that the festival has become known for. These are set to be announced in mid April but it’s expected that there will be a mix of old and new events at venues such as Kelvingrove Bandstand, Glasgow Botanic Gardens and Mansfield Park.
In addition look out for superb galas, street theatre, cabaret, choral events, brass band concerts and lots more!
